Beloved Shirts Shark Tank Net Worth 2023

Beloved Shirts is a clothing brand that appeared on Shark Tank in March 2016. During the pitch, founder Jeremiah Robison requested $175,000 in exchange for a 5% ownership stake in Beloved Shirts, valuing the company at $3.5 million.

However, he left the show without any deal from the Sharks. Despite this setback, Beloved Shirts has continued to grow and expand its business. As of January 2023, the company’s net worth is estimated to be around $4 million. The brand has gained popularity due to its quirky and fun designs on apparel.
Beloved Shirts uses sublimation printing to create their products, which are made in the USA using dye-sublimation technology. All of their products are “made to order,” so they do not have any inventory to worry about. However, it takes 30 days from ordering to delivery which can be an issue.
Jeremiah Robison’s appearance on Shark Tank has helped Beloved Shirts gain more exposure and grow its business. The company’s annual revenue is now estimated at $4 million as of January 2023.

What Is Beloved Shirts?

Beloved Shirts is a company that uses a cutting-edge printing technique to create playful and quirky clothing with unique designs. Their printing method fully envelops the design around the apparel, giving it a 360-degree view that turns the fabric into a canvas for artists.

Initially, Beloved Shirts started as a clothing line, but they have now diversified their product range to include accessories like hoodies, onesies, trousers, socks, caps, and more.

Their collection showcases designs such as the gushing unicorn, the big hamburger, and Kin Jong Un prints. Customers can also create their own designs. Beloved Shirts’ outfits are conversation starters and have gained popularity among celebrities like Katie Perry, who is often spotted wearing her pizza onesie.

Beloved Shirts products can be found on Amazon, and many are eligible for Prime delivery. All of their items are made in the United States using dye-sublimation printers, which can print any image or design on a variety of apparel items.

Jeremiah Robison, the founder of Beloved Shirts, hails from Provo, Utah. In 2012, while playing indoor soccer, he had the idea of featuring realistic images of food on his team’s shirts, which he thought would be amusing and distracting to their opponents. This led to the creation of Beloved Shirts using the sublimation printing method.

What Happened To Beloved Shirts At The Shark Tank Pitch?

During Season 7 Episode 21 of Shark Tank, Jeremiah pitched his company and requested $175,000 in exchange for a 5% stake, which valued his company at $3.5 million. He impressed the Sharks by handing out personalized samples of his work, including products featuring their faces.

Jeremiah’s profit margin was between 58 and 60 percent, and he had sold $2.3 million worth of merchandise in two and a half years.

However, the turnaround time for orders was 30 days, and he had 22,000 SKUs on his website, which Lori Greiner thought was too many. She suggested that he reduce the number of SKUs to his top ten products and warehouse them for immediate delivery.

Mark Cuban recognized that Jeremiah’s business strategy needed refinement before he could receive more investment, and Robert Herjavec withdrew due to a conflict of interest. Kevin O’Leary was dissatisfied with the company’s valuation, and Daymond John refrained from investing at less than 17 percent.

However, Daymond made an offer of $175,000 for a 25% stake, which Jeremiah declined. After some negotiation, Daymond agreed to reduce the stake to 22.5%, but Jeremiah still refused the offer.

Beloved Shirts After The Shark Tank Pitch

Although Jeremiah didn’t win anything from the tank, his participation on the show has brought about noteworthy advancements for the company within six months after the episode aired.

Jeremiah was able to reduce the number of unique products that the firm supplies and cut down on fixed expenses.

One of the most significant improvements in customer satisfaction has been the decrease in the time it takes for orders to be processed. Beloved Shirts is now able to fulfill made-to-order items in just five days, thanks to innovations in their production process.

As of April 2021, the company continues to thrive, generating an annual revenue of $4 million.

Beloved Shirts FAQS

What is Beloved Shirts?

Beloved Shirts is a manufacturing firm that creates funny tees and garments based on user submitted pictures.

Who is the founder of Beloved Shirts?

Jeremiah Robison is the owner as well as a designer of Beloved Shirts.

How much was he seeking in the Shark Tank?

Jeremiah was seeking $175,000 in exchange for a 5% stake.

Did he get the deal from the Sharks?

Jeremiah did not get a deal from the Sharks.

Is Beloved Shirts still in business?

The firm is still running strong in April 2021, with yearly revenue of $4 million.

Where are Beloved Shirts made?

Everything is currently made in the United States. However, if orders increase in size, Jeremiah might have to look for another location to produce his goods.

What episode was Beloved Shirts featured on Shark Tank?

Beloved Shirts was on season 7 Episode 21 of Shark Tank.
